How do i get my back wheel to pop higher? by ThatOneRcKid in mountainbiking

[–]Phil20AD 0 points1 point  (0 children)

If you want to clean two wheel hop it, practice timing of your pop and really work on the unweighting (scooping the pedals) + tucking. Your Yank and compression is on point. Just hump the bars harder sooner, followed by superman your arms and try to sniff your seat at the same time, lol. Honestly, that little front wheel bump, is the foundation of a pretty advanced hop, "front bump/tap"(use the object to create more lift). Notice how your front wheel goes upwards even more after bumping the edge. If you're comfortable and able to keep that timing/front wheel placement-- with that technique, time your pop/hop closer to when your front wheel touches (in the video you're a touch late). Again, hump and superman tuck.

How can i improve my jumping by shmidzz in MTB

[–]Phil20AD 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Can you get involved in the jump maintenance there? Do some work, pay your dues, learn to stack, shape, pack and slap. Then maybe get to building new line, or adding lips, or rebuilding a line. If its anything like the jumps I've been part of, the trails are a slowly evolving thing, done by those shoveling. Usually a sound group, shared pain and love of jumps.
